What is the difference between Practicum Intern vs Clinical Intern?
| Aspect | Practicum Intern | Clinical Intern |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Usually enrolled in relevant academic programs, some may have certifications | Typically students in health or mental health fields, may have certifications |
| Work Environment | Educational settings, internships in organizations, community programs | Healthcare facilities, hospitals, clinics |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Educational institutions, non-profits, community organizations | Hospitals, clinics, mental health agencies |
| Common Search & Comparison | Yes | Yes |
The Practicum Intern and Clinical Intern roles often overlap in educational and training settings, but Practicum Interns typically focus on gaining general experience in community or organizational environments, while Clinical Interns are more involved in healthcare or mental health clinical settings. Both roles are essential for students pursuing careers in health, social work, or related fields, and their distinctions mainly lie in the specific work environment and industry focus.

An Overview Under the direction of Early Childhood Wellness Program Manager, this individual will serve as subject matter expert for infants and toddlers with delays and disorders in social-emotional development, cognitive development (particularly sensorimotor and preoperational), atypical development including autism spectrum disorder, developmental disabilities, and behavior.
A Senior Therapist in the Part C Early Intervention Program provides clinical assessment, intervention and therapeutic services for families of children with atypical development in areas that may impact their integration within home, education or community environments. Employees in this class provide diagnostic assessments which provide therapeutic information and guide the therapist in the need for referring the child or family to additional treatment services, job opportunities, medical treatment, and other community referral sources, as needed. The therapist generally conducts these tasks during regular working hours.
The incumbents in this class may serve as clinical supervisor for practicum/intern students. The work is performed under the general supervision of a program or team leader, but the employee works with considerable independence in completing assigned tasks. The individual in this role will provide coaching and guidance to the Service Coordinators who are responsible for providing individualized developmental services and family supports that promote the development of children and increase the self-sufficiency of families as outlined under Part C of The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(I.D.E.A.) and its supporting regulations
The Senior Therapist will provide case management, consultative and direct services to individuals with developmental delays and disabilities, birth to age three and their families, to ensure that infants and toddlers with developmental delays and disabilities receive necessary services commensurate to their needs on an as needed basis. What You Should Bring Thorough knowledge of individual and group behavior including thorough knowledge of treatment issues related to psychiatric problems, dual-diagnosis, and chemical dependency; good knowledge of psychopharmacology, psychiatric disorders, alcoholism/drug addiction, juvenile delinquency, and/or elderly and aging; ability to work successfully with a variety of consumers; ability to communicate clearly and effectively, both verbally and in writing with other professionals and with the public; ability to plan and supervise the work of interns or students. About the Department The Center for Children and Families (CCF) provides programs and services for Behavioral Health, Domestic Violence & Sexual Assault, Child Welfare & Child Protective Services, Early Childhood and Youth Development.
CCF provides compassionate, collaborative and effective person and family-centered services based on best practices. Our teams support self-determination, safety, recovery and resiliency for Alexandria children and all residents affected by abuse, neglect, mental illness, intellectual disabilities and substance abuse disorders. Minimum & Additional Requirements Possession of Master's degree in Social Work, Mental Health Counseling, Psychology, Education or related field; at least two years of post-graduate work experience in providing direct clinical services to consumers having one or more substance abuse, psychiatric, and emotional disorders; and licensure or license eligible (has completed all required education and supervision as required by applicable board) as a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C),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W), Licensed Substance Abuse Treatment Practitioner (LSATP) or Clinical Psychologist in the Commonwealth of Virginia at the time of appointment; if license eligible, the employee must obtain Virginia licensure at the first available opportunity, but no later than one year after appointment; or any equivalent combination of experience and training which provides the required knowledge, skills and abilities.
Employees must possess a valid driver's license issued by the state of their residence if they are in a position with driving responsibilities. Preferred Qualifications At least one year of prior experience providing intervention to infants 0-3. Endorsement as an Infant Mental Health Specialist or Infant Mental Health Mentor.
Training or experience in adult learning principles. Ability to provide services as a bilingual therapist. At least one year of personnel experience in providing Part C early intervention supports and services in Virginia.
Must meet the discipline-specific requirements for one of the following: Counselor, Human Development and Family, Family Therapist, Psychologist, or Social Worker. Certified by the State Lead Agency both as an Early Intervention Professional and Early Intervention Case Manager. At least three years or more of clinical job experience.
